Open Sans
Open Sans is a highly legible and versatile sans-serif font. It is suitable for body text and headings. Open Sans is a good alternative to Aspect Range Font when you need a clean and modern look. It has a similar feel but with a more modern twist.
Lato
Lato is a sans-serif font with a strong and modern feel. It has a subtle geometric shape and is highly legible. Lato is a good alternative to Aspect Range Font when you need a font that is easy to read and has a touch of elegance.

Inter
Inter is a modern sans-serif font designed for digital use. It has a clean and elegant feel and is highly legible. Inter is a good alternative to Aspect Range Font when you need a font that is easy to read and has a touch of sophistication.
